Aroldis Chapman’s fastball set the stage ablaze in his Rangers Debut

The acquisition of former Kansas City Royals reliever Aroldis Chapman marked a significant and distinctive move by the Texas Rangers. Now firmly settled in Texas, the former Yankees pitcher embraced the chance to showcase precisely why the Rangers had pursued him through the trade.

Sunday, when the Rangers played the Houston Astros, Aroldis Chapman made his first appearance as a Texas player. Fox Sports said that he had a great scoreless inning where he showed off his famous fastball by striking out two batters and left fans in awe of his skill.

Despite the Houston Astros prevailing with a 5-3 victory over the Rangers, Texas maintains its advantage in the AL West. Holding a commendable 50-34 record, the Rangers possess a four-game lead over Houston. By acquiring Aroldis Chapman, the team aims to solidify its position as the frontrunner in the division, determined to maintain their stronghold atop the AL West.

After a great game on Sunday, Aroldis Chapman was able to get his earned run average (ERA) down to a very good 2.37 for the season. He has shown off his amazing throwing skills by having a K/BB ratio of 55:20, which is a very good number. Even though Aroldis Chapman may not be in as many ninth-inning situations as he was when he played for the New York Yankees, the versatile closer has proven that he can do well in any role.

This presents a significant advantage for the Rangers, as it addresses one of their primary concerns. Presently, Texas’ bullpen holds the 24th position in the MLB with a 4.45 earned run average (ERA). With Aroldis Chapman performing at his peak, he has the potential to greatly enhance the Rangers’ most prominent vulnerability, providing much-needed support to their struggling bullpen.

Defying his age of 35, Aroldis Chapman demonstrated his ability to unleash blazing fastballs, surpassing the 100-mile-per-hour mark on the radar gun. With his arrival following the trade from the Royals, the Rangers are eagerly anticipating Aroldis Chapman’s scorching velocity to ignite their journey toward a deep playoff run. Texas envisions him bringing the heat to the Lone Star State, infusing their pitching arsenal with a formidable weapon capable of propelling them toward postseason success.

Aroldis Chapman’s Texas move

When Aroldis Chapman made the decision to sign with the Kansas City Royals during the offseason, it’s probable that he envisioned scenarios like this unfolding. Undoubtedly, he sought financial stability and a platform to showcase his pitching skills. Considering his controversial past, including a suspension for domestic abuse and a somewhat contentious departure from the Yankees when he was excluded from the previous year’s postseason roster, it is conceivable that Aroldis Chapman faced limited offers. However, by joining the Royals, he embraced the opportunity for redemption and a chance to prove his worth once again.

In addition, it’s worth mentioning the tattoo incident that occurred during the season, which unfortunately led to an infection and placed him on the injury list. Furthermore, Aroldis Chapman’s persistent control issues seemed to arise like hives during critical moments.

Putting all those factors aside, Aroldis Chapman surely calculated that if he performed exceptionally for the Royals, who were projected to be a struggling team, he would likely be traded to a more competitive contender.

Aroldis proved to be a very smart person when his well-thought-out plan worked out. In line with his insight, he has now joined the Texas Rangers, who are currently five games ahead of the Houston Astros in the AL West. This was made even more clear when they beat the Astros 5-2 on Saturday.

Aroldis Chapman expressed his satisfaction and enthusiasm on Saturday, as conveyed through an interpreter, according to the Dallas Morning News. He mentioned being genuinely content with the team’s current battle for a playoff spot, stating that he was thrilled and excited about the prospect. Chapman also shared his happiness regarding the situation.

At 35 years of age, Aroldis Chapman boasts an impressive track record as a seven-time All-Star. During his tenure with the Royals, he showcased his skills with a remarkable 2.45 ERA across 29.1 innings of play. Facing 122 batters, he demonstrated his dominance by striking out an impressive 53 of them, resulting in a striking 43% strikeout percentage, which stands as one of the highest among qualified relievers. Notably, his four-seam fastball maintains an average speed of 99.4 mph, while his sinker occasionally surpasses the 100 mph mark, further adding to his arsenal of formidable pitches.

Chapman expressed his satisfaction with his time in Kansas City, stating that everything went great for him there. He acknowledged having a pretty good year and expressed gratitude for the overall experience.

Nathan Eovaldi of the Rangers threw an impressive seven innings without conceding any runs, securing his position as the American League’s second pitcher to reach 10 wins this season. Interestingly, Aroldis Chapman was present in the bullpen during the game but did not get the opportunity to warm up.

Manager Bruce Bochy expressed his anticipation and excitement regarding Aroldis Chapman’s arrival, stating that he is looking forward to having him on the team. Bochy emphasized that Chapman’s addition has significantly improved the team as a whole, particularly the bullpen, making them stronger and more formidable.
